work
Artist Profile
CV
meet
About
Values
Press
Menu
work
Artist Profile
CV
meet
About
Values
Press
2017 INTERNATIONAL SYMPOSIUM OF ELECTRONIC ARTS, COLOMBIA
June 2, 2017
← 2018 CSM : BODY DATA TALK AND DEMO
2017 PROPELA PRESENTS, THE FUTURE OF, LONDON →